What $500,000 will buy you right now all over Greater Boston

Our picks range from a floor-through unit in Somerville to a triangular-shaped contemporary in Easton.

51 West Woodbridge Road in North Andover is listed for $499,900. via MLS

For half a million dollars in Greater Boston, you can have your pick of a wide variety of properties. For sale at this price point is a floor-through condo in Somerville, a two-bedroom condo in Dorchester, a home with an open-concept floor plan in Swampscott, a Colonial in North Andover, and a triangular-shaped home in Easton on a cul-de-sac.

See them here, ordered from the highest price per square foot to the lowest:
